New Year Marketing Checklist

A new year is the perfect time to reset and realign your marketing efforts. Before things get busy, take a moment to check these off your list:

  • Review last year's performance and key takeaways
  • Set clear Q1 marketing goals and KPI's
  • Update branding, visuals, or website content as needed
  • Plan messaging, promotions, and content for the coming season

Devotional

“Jesus answered, 'I am the way and the truth and the life. No one comes to the Father except through me.'” John 14:6 (NIV)


Are you ever frustrated when a speaker gives you an outline with blanks but then skips some of the points? Me too. We like complete outlines. All the blanks filled in. All the gaps closed. All the details disclosed. All the questions answered to our satisfaction.


But that’s not the way life is. Some gaps are too wide to close. And there are some questions for which there are no apparent answers. I believe that’s the way God wants it. Our all-knowing God not only allows this but actually designed life to be this way.


Without blanks, there would be no room for Him to enter in and write His answers. Like how Jesus answered His disciples in John 14:6: “I am the way and the truth and the life.” He is the way when there is no way. The truth when lies long to consume our thoughts. The life on the other side of our crumbling attempts to control our stories.


Our God is not fickle, forgetful, or fragile in any way. He does not make mistakes. He purposes the gaps. He allows sacred spaces and blank places. He leaves room.


If we had all the blanks filled in, we would explain away God’s part in our story. God doesn’t want to be explained away. He wants to be invited in.
